UML 是消息系统的良好表示法吗?
自从企业集成模式发布以来,人们一直在使用那本书记录了异步异构消息传递系统。
但我们的商店或多或少是围绕专门执行 UML 的专有文档工具进行标准化的。 标准 UML 图之一是否适合记录异步消息传递系统,包括变压器、路由器等? 如果有,是哪一个? 如果不是,那么反对为此目的调整 UML 的杀手锏是什么?
Ever since the publication of Enterprise Integration Patterns people have been using the notation introduced in that book for documenting asynchronous heterogenous messaging systems.
But our shop is more or less standardized around a proprietary documentation tool that does exclusively UML. Is one of the standard UML diagrams appropriate for documenting asynchronous messaging systems, including transformers, routers et al.? If yes, which one? If not, what would be a killer argument against the tweaking of UML for this purpose?
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论
评论(2)
UML 提供了一种通过 配置文件 进行扩展的机制。
配置文件允许您指定构造型,标记值和约束。
每个构造型都可以有一个可选的构造型图标。
也许您可以下载 UML 的 EIP 配置文件?
如果没有,您可以构建自己的配置文件(如果您的 UML 工具支持此功能),并使用 Gregor Hohpe 的网站
希望这会有所帮助。
UML provides a mechanism for extension through profiles
A profile allows you to specify stereotypes, tagged values, and constraints.
Every stereotype can have an optional stereotype icon.
Perhaps there is an EIP profile for UML you could download?
If not, you can build your own profile if your UML tool supports this, and use the icons available as Visio shapes from Gregor Hohpe's website
Hope this helps.
我认为工具包一语中的。 EIP 的作者自己在他们的书简介中引用了 UML 配置文件。 他们提供的链接已损坏,请按照此链接访问 OMG 的 UML 企业应用程序集成配置文件。
I think toolkit hit the nail on the head. The authors of EIP themselves refer to a UML profile in the introduction to their book. The link they give is broken though, follow instead this link to the OMG's UML Enterprise Application Integration profile.